Output 73b642cedacebfded6429309c8ea8e76bc1b547b7edb5575d6ee3fbbf382d0f4:7

value
153959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26422bf811e4f519132fe2ababd23de33ad00474 OP_EQUAL
address
35BJsXYMuNdB7ELymuimz5pgzfs5zJ5Stw
transaction
73b642cedacebfded6429309c8ea8e76bc1b547b7edb5575d6ee3fbbf382d0f4
confirmations
260844
spent
true